Output c820517bb623349d2acdd187c19288ec959a1eec3f0289526788c0912df5aa19:0

value
38482877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8639764859a8858c3b31a3a1cc61d46ec4c979f5 OP_EQUAL
address
ML8scfhjxSAaVBNQKPcuxDxghWdN6c9BQw
transaction
c820517bb623349d2acdd187c19288ec959a1eec3f0289526788c0912df5aa19
spent
true